مرتبط با :
ترفند برنامه
پاك كردن یك آدرس سایت بخصوص از كامپیوتر
ممكن است تا به حال شما هم با این موضوع برخورد كرده باشید. فرض كنید كه بخواهید url های ( آدرسی كه با آن صفحات وب را نشان میدهیم ) منفردی ( و نه تمام url های موجود در history اینترنت اكسپلورر ) را از نوار آدرس حذف كنید. مثلا میخواهید آدرس http://www.yahoo.com را حذف كنید. من سعی كردم این كار را با هایلایت كردن urlی كه میخواهم از نوار آدرس حذف كنم انجام بدهم و سپس با زدن delete آنرا حذف كنم، اما از طریق این روش هرگز موفق نمیشدم ( اگر بخواهید با این روش url را حذف كنید. پس از های لایت كردن اگر بخواهید روی آن url كلیك راست كنید تا delete را بزنید، كلیك راست هیچ چیزی را نشان نمیدهد ) من همیشه دنبال راه حلی میگشتم تا بتوانم از آن استفاده كنم تا url های منفرد را بدون delete كردن كل url های موجود در history حذف كنم.
اگر دقت كرده باشید هنگامی كه شما در نوار آدرس اینترنت اكسپلورر شروع به تایپ كردن آدرسی میكنید یك یا چند url كه قبلا شما از آن بازدید كرده باشید در نوار آدرس ظاهر میشود. (مثلا وقتی میخواهید به سایت yahoo بروید به محض تایپ كردن حرف y آدرس سایت یاهو و یا هر سایت دیگری كه با حرف y آغاز شود در آنجا ظاهر میشود) باید بدانید این آدرسی كه در آنجا نمایش پیدا میكند از 2 محل گرفته شده است.
1.حافظه مرورگر شما(history)
2.كلیدهای رجیستری كه موجب میشوند تا url هایی كه قبلا مستقیما در نوار آدرس تایپ كرده بوده اید ذخیره شود.
بنابراین شما برای حذف، باید url مورد نظر خود را در هر 2 جا پیدا كنید و آنرا delete كنید. ابتدا آن را از history مرورگرتان حذف كنید. برای این كار دكمه history را از نوار ابزار كلیك كنید تا در سمت چپ مرورگرتان، history قرار بگیرد. سپس در قسمت بالایی منوی view را انتخاب كنید و گزینه by site را انتخاب كنید تا لیست url هایی را كه تا به حال سر زده اید به صورت ترتیب الفبایی ظاهر شود. اگر url را كه میخواهید حذف كنید در آنجا وجود داشت، بر روی آن راست كلیك كنید و delete را بزنید. با انجام این كار نصف راه طی شده است و توانسته اید url را از history حذف كنید. اما اگر url كه میخواستید حذف كنید در history وجود نداشت و یا علیرغم حذف آن از آنجا، هنگام تایپ آدرسی در اینترنت اكسپلورر دوباره آن آدرس در آنجا نشان داده میشد، باید مرحله دوم یعنی حذف آن از رجیستری را نیز انجام بدهید، تا مطمئن شوید url مورد نظر شما حتما بطور كامل حذف شده است. برای این كار از منوی start ویندوز، گزینه run را انتخاب كنید، عبارت regedit را تایپ كنید تا به قسمت رجیستری ویندوز بروید. سپس مسیر زیر را طی كنید تا به قسمت url های ذخیره شده بروید:
hkey_current_user \ software \ microsoft \ internet explorer \ typedurls
مقادیر سمت راست دارای مقادیری بصورت url1, url2, url3 هستند كه هر كدام حاوی آدرسی منحصربه فرد هستند. (مثلا http://www.yahoo.com) لیست را جستجو كنید تا url مورد نظر خود را پیدا كنید. سپس آنرا حذف كنید. حالا كار تمام است و میتوانید مطمئن باشید كه url مورد نظرتان كاملا حذف شده است و دیگر در نوار آدرس اینترنت اكسپلورر نمایش داده نمیشود. اكنون آنچه شما نیاز دارید این است كه حفره ای كه بر اثر حذف url مورد نظرتان ایجاد شده را بپوشانید. در لیست، urlی را كه بیشترین مقدار را دارد، پیدا كنید ( توجه كنید كه اگر url ها بر اساس متن مرتب شده باشند url10 قبل از url2 میآید ) و مقدار آنرا با url ای كه حذف كرده اید عوض كنید. مثلا فرض كنید شما در لیست url7 را حذف كرده اید و در لیست بزرگترین مقدار url20 است . شما اكنون باید مقدار url20 را به url7 تغییر بدهید تا حفره بوجود آمده را بپوشانید. توجه كنید انجام این كار ضروری است و اگر این كار را نكنید اینترنت اكسپلورر سایر url هایی را كه بعد از url حذف شده قرار دارند را، هم حذف شده در نظر میگیرد. مثلا اگر مقدار حذف شده url7 باشد، سایر url هایی را كه بعد از آن قرار میگیرند، دیگر در نظر نمیگیرد و مثلا url7 با آنها برخورد میكند
...